@import url(https://fonts.googleapis.com/css2?family=Roboto&display=swap);@import url(https://fonts.googleapis.com/css2?family=Bacasime+Antique&display=swap);@import url(https://fonts.googleapis.com/css2?family=Sacramento&display=swap);@import url(https://fonts.googleapis.com/css2?family=Ysabeau+Infant:ital,wght@0,1;0,100;0,200;0,300;0,400;0,500;0,600;0,700;0,800;1,1&display=swap);h1{font-size:2.5em}*,:after,:before{border:none;box-sizing:border-box;margin:0;padding:0}html{padding:0;scroll-behavior:smooth}body,html{box-sizing:border-box;height:100%;margin:0;width:100%}body{background-color:#f7ffe5;color:#215405;font-family:Ysabeau Infant,sans-serif;font-size:1rem;overflow-x:hidden;position:relative}#root{height:100%;width:100%}.flex{display:flex;width:100%}.flex-fd-c{flex-direction:column}.flex-jc-sb{justify-content:space-between}.flex-jc-c{justify-content:center}.flex-jc-sa{justify-content:space-around}.flex-jc-se{justify-content:space-evenly}.flex-jc-fe{justify-content:flex-end}.flex-jc-fs{justify-content:flex-start}.flex-ai-c{align-items:center}.flex-ai-fe{align-items:flex-end}.default-pad{padding:8%}a,a:active,a:focus,a:hover{color:#3f6927;text-decoration:none;transition:all .15s ease-in-out}a:active:hover,a:focus:hover,a:hover,a:hover:hover{color:#215405}.highlight{color:#ffbfca}.highlight2{color:#c4717f;font-weight:900}.button{background-color:#f7ffe5;border:1px solid #a0c49d;cursor:pointer;line-height:.8;padding:.625rem .875rem;text-align:center;transition:all .15s ease-in-out}.button:hover{background-color:#e1ecc8}nav{background-color:#f7ffe5;font-family:Ysabeau Infant,sans-serif;font-size:1.2rem;height:50px;position:relative;z-index:1}nav i{color:#ffbfca;font-size:1.5rem;transition:all .15s ease-in-out}nav i:hover{opacity:.8;-webkit-transform:scale(1.09);transform:scale(1.09)}.hero{background-image:url(/static/media/Asset1.e87805c320918ff51269.svg);background-position:50%;background-repeat:no-repeat;background-size:150px;border-bottom:5px double #215405;gap:10%;height:100%}.hero .join-classes{gap:20px}.classes-intro{background-attachment:fixed;background-blend-mode:luminosity;background-color:#f7ffe5;background-image:url(/static/media/classesIntro3.6344b85d9d36dff3e6d3.jpg);background-position:50%;background-repeat:no-repeat;background-size:100%;border-bottom:5px double #215405;gap:10%;height:100%}.classes-intro p{background-color:rgba(247,255,229,.412);border-radius:10px}.quotes{background-image:url(/static/media/Asset2.0a4bb4aa3d29eff34076.svg);background-position:50%;background-size:250px;border-bottom:5px double #215405;height:100%}.newsletter,.quotes{background-repeat:no-repeat}.newsletter{background-image:url(/static/media/Asset3.0a2b1e7074206f8503dd.svg);background-position:top 15% center;background-size:150px;gap:3%;height:50%}.newsletter input{background-color:#e1ecc8;border-radius:5px;padding:3px 5px}.newsletter button{cursor:pointer;font-family:Ysabeau Infant,sans-serif}footer{background-color:#e1ecc8;font-size:.8rem;padding:5px 0;text-align:center}@media screen and (min-width:768px){.newsletter{padding:0 0 5%}}.classes{gap:5%;padding-bottom:30px}.classes,.classes>:not(h2){height:-webkit-fit-content;height:-moz-fit-content;height:fit-content}.classes>:not(h2){background-color:#a0c49d;border-radius:15px;box-shadow:0 15px 41px 9px rgba(33,84,5,.51);padding:4%}.classes>:not(h2)>:not(:first-child){margin-top:20px}.classes>:not(:last-child){margin-bottom:20%}.classes h2{color:#f7ffe5}.classes img{border:2px solid #fff;border-radius:15px;mix-blend-mode:darken;width:100%}.classes p,.classes ul{color:#fff;font-size:1.2rem;font-weight:700;margin-right:auto}.classes ul{list-style:inside;width:100%}@media screen and (min-width:768px){.classes{flex-direction:row;gap:1%;height:100%;padding:4% 2%}.classes>*{margin-bottom:0!important}.classes img{transition:all .2s ease-in-out}.classes p,.classes ul{font-size:1rem}.classes ul{list-style:outside;width:140%}.classes>*,.classes>* img{transition:all .2s ease-in-out}.classes>:hover{-webkit-transform:scale(1.05);transform:scale(1.05)}.classes>:hover img{mix-blend-mode:normal;opacity:.8}}#blogs-header{color:#3f6927;font-family:Sacramento,cursive;font-size:3rem;margin-left:100px;padding-top:60px}.blogs{background-color:#f7ffe5;flex-wrap:wrap;gap:20px;height:100%;padding:60px 20px 20px;width:100%}.blogs .each-blog{background-color:#e1ecc8;border-radius:10px;cursor:pointer;gap:10px;outline:2px solid #215405;padding:15px;transition:all .15s ease-in-out;width:95%}.blogs .each-blog h2,.blogs .each-blog p{color:#3f6927;margin-right:auto}.blogs .each-blog:hover{box-shadow:0 15px 41px 9px rgba(33,84,5,.51);outline:0 solid #215405;-webkit-transform:scale(1.05);transform:scale(1.05)}.blogs img{border-radius:10px;max-width:100%}.about{height:-webkit-min-content;height:min-content;width:100%}.about h2{color:#ffbfca;margin:10px 0}.contact{height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;width:100%}.contact h2{color:#ffbfca;margin:10px 0}
/*# sourceMappingURL=main.b30954f5.css.map*/